研究概览
简要总结
Diabetes mellitus is a major public health problem and it is estimated that 300 million individuals will be affected by the year 2030. Non-diabetic ulcers are one of the most frequent complications of this disease and, if untreated, can lead to the amputation of lower limbs. Thus, there has been growing interest in the use of light emitting diode (LED) devices to accelerate the tissue repair process and lower the cost of ulcer treatment in this population. The Mandaqui hospital complex is a general, tertiary, teaching hospital that is a reference center for revascularization surgery and endovascular treatment in Brazil. The aim of the proposed study is to evaluate the action of LED therapy on the complete healing of ulcers following minor amputations in patients with Diabetes mellitus. Methods: A single-center, randomized, controlled, double-blind, clinical trial with two parallel groups will be conducted following the criteria of the CONSORT Statement. The project will be registered with www.clinicaltrials.gov. The sample will be composed of 40 patients with a diagnosis of Diabetes mellitus in follow up at the vascular clinic of Mandaqui hospital complex who meet the inclusion criteria. The control group (n = 20) will receive traditional rayon bandages with essential fatty acids and secondary coverage with gauze, which will be changed on a weekly basis. The treatment group (n = 20) will be submitted to LED therapy (635 nm; 4 J/cm2; 10 minutes) with weekly applications and the ulcers will also receive the traditional bandage treatment described above. The patients will be followed up until the complete closure of the ulcer, which will be the primary outcome. The ulcers will be examined on a weekly basis by a researcher with no awareness regarding the allocation of the individuals to the different groups and will assess, signs of infection, edema, redness, heat and the presence of gangrene. Photographs of the ulcers will also be taken for the subsequent determination of the area. Another researcher with no knowledge regarding the allocation of the participants will measure the surface of the ulcers with the aid of the ImageJ software program. The data will be submitted to appropriate statistical analyses. After closure of the ulcers, the patients will be followed up for a period of six months.
详细描述
Justification Various studies have demonstrated that phototherapy (laser or LED) is effective at enhancing skin wounds. The biological effects of both forms are similar and related to an increase in fibroblasts, the stimulation of angiogenesis, an increase in collagen synthesis, the formulation of granulation tissue and a reduction in inflammatory cells. Moreover, both forms of phototherapy increase the healed area in a shorter period of time, with LED demonstrating a late-onset effect on the healing process. In patients with partial foot amputation, this time is crucial for the fitting of the prosthetic and, consequently, the beginning of physical therapy and early locomotion. Diminishing the treatment time, with the patient observing a gradual progression in the healing process and experiencing a consequent increase in quality of life, could be a transforming factor to avoid the recurrence of ulcers and avoid further amputations.
Hypothesis
Alternative hypothesis: LED therapy is effective at potentiating the complete closure of ulcers in a shorter time following minor amputations in individuals with Diabetes mellitus.
Hull hypothesis: LED therapy is not effective at potentiating the complete closure of ulcers in a shorter time following minor amputations in individuals with Diabetes mellitus.
Methods A single-center, randomized, controlled, double-blind clinical trial with two parallel groups will be conducted in accordance with the criteria contained in the Consolidated Standards of Reporting Trials (CONSORT statement).

入选标准
- •age 18 years or older;
- •type 2 diabetes;
- •either gender;
- •adequate cognitive capacity to maintain the foot without load or pressure as much as possible based on the location of the ulcer;
- •under care at the vascular surgery outpatient clinic of the Mandaqui Hospital Complex between January 2017 and december 2018, having undergone partial minor amputation at the same hospital (toes, foot, disarticulation at the metatarsal-phalangeal or transmetatarsal joint).
排除标准
- •presence of infected ulcers;
- •under surveillance for cancer or having undergone anti-neoplasm treatment in previous three months;
- •currently pregnant or nursing;
- •uncontrolled diabetes;
- •Neuropathic arthropathy;
- •participation in other concomitant clinical trial.
结局指标
主要结局
Wound closure
时间窗: 6 months
The primary outcome will be the complete closure of the ulcer, which is defined as 100% epithelialization of the operated surface with no exudate, draining or need for bandages.
次要结局
- Time for closure(up to 6 months)
- Cost-benefit ratio of ulcer treatment following minor amputations(up to 6 months)
- Ulcer closure rate(up to 6 months)
